Tune into Olympic soundtrack

PUBS can help their customers relive the opening ceremony of London 2012 – by downloading the official soundtrack to their jukebox.

Soundnet, the pub entertainment supplier, has confirmed the 36-track compilation, released on Decca Records, is now available on its Milestones in Music digital jukebox.
The album, which went to no.1 in the UK iTunes store on its release, features Arctic Monkeys, Mike Oldfield and Dizzee Rascal, who all performed during the Danny Boyle directed opening ceremony.
Soundnet’s Toby Hoyte said the move highlights the firm’s “proactive approach” to putting new releases on its systems.
